My Name is Khan is a moving and ambitious social drama that remains one of the most significant collaborations between director Karan Johar and the iconic pair of Shah Rukh Khan and Kajol. Released in 2010, the film successfully pivots from a personal love story to a global message about religious identity and human goodness. Plot Summary
The story follows Rizwan Khan (Shah Rukh Khan), a Muslim man with Asperger’s Syndrome living in San Francisco. He marries Mandira (Kajol), a single mother, but their lives are shattered by the prejudice and Islamophobia that followed the September 11 attacks. After a personal tragedy, Rizwan embarks on a cross-country journey across America to meet the President and deliver a simple but powerful message: "My name is Khan, and I am not a terrorist". Themes and Social Commentary
One of the standout aspects of "My Name is Khan" is its fearless approach to tackling complex social issues. The film sheds light on the struggles faced by Muslims in the post-9/11 world, where Islamophobia was on the rise. Through Rizwan's story, the movie humanizes the experiences of Muslims, showcasing their fears, anxieties, and hopes.
The film also explores the theme of identity, questioning what it means to be an Indian, a Muslim, or an American. Rizwan's Asperger's syndrome serves as a metaphor for the ways in which society often marginalizes and misunderstands those who are different.
Karan Johar's direction and the performances of the lead actors earned widespread critical acclaim. Shah Rukh Khan, in particular, received praise for his nuanced portrayal of Rizwan, bringing depth and empathy to the character.
